6 Space Activity in Romania The ROmanian Space Agency ROSA is the Romanian Governmental structure which coordinates the Romanian Space Program and has a representative role in the cooperation with similar international organizations Recently, ROSA has established protocols of cooperation with European Space Agency and NASA, continuing a tradition of space activities and cooperation begun in the ‘70 with former INTERCOSMOS

18 The Telemedicine Pilot Structure The Pilot is intended to cover, at this stage, the Department of General Surgery and Liver Transplantation (DLT) as well as the Department of Medical Imaging (DMI). The structure of the Pilot follows the standard structure of a telemedicine system, as presented in the tutorial part of this presentation, adapted to the strategic needs of the project. The next slide shows a view of the system related to the intended telemedicine audience.
19
19 The Fundeni Telemedicine Pilot Links Medical units in Romania Fundeni Medical units abroad Internet barebone
20
20 The Telemedicine Pilot Environment In the Pilot phase the Fundeni Telemedicine Pilot is connected with standing, accessible medical sites in Romania and abroad. The main communication link is through Internet (over IP); The occasional communication link is radio, through satellite channel or radio streamer. Both kind of links can connect the same sites.

27 Demonstration Pilot for Humans Monitoring under High Risk Conditions
28
28 Project Goals Modeling of a rescue service for persons with high risk for survival (cardiovascular patients, diabetic patients, handicapped persons, aged people, etc.); Testing a pilot of the service in simulated conditions on kayak embarked sportsmen; Evaluation of the pilot potential for other social spin-offs as further applications in sports, healthcare and security.
29
29 Principle of Operation GSM medium GPS Satellite Rescue initiation Evaluation & Decision
30
30 Monitoring Service Tasks Real time acquisition of the GPS reported position of person and sensor based acquisition of functional parameters; Evaluation of functional parameters and alarm initiation; Alarm parameter evaluation and rescue procedure initiation; Off-line records for further evaluations.
